McIntosh launches CS7500 two-channel streaming preamplifier
McIntosh has launched the CS7500 as a two-channel solid-state preamplifier with integrated network playback. Its stated frequency response is +0/-0.5dB from 20Hz to 20kHz. Extended response reaches +0/-3dB from 15Hz to 100kHz.

McIntosh has introduced the CS7500, a two-channel solid-state streaming preamplifier. Its digital section is built around a Quad Balanced eight-channel DAC architecture. Over USB, the CS7500 accepts PCM at resolutions up to 32-bit/384kHz and DXD at sample rates of 352.8kHz or 384kHz. Total harmonic distortion is 0.005%, and the high-level signal-to-noise ratio is 100dB.
For analog sources, the CS7500 provides two balanced line inputs and three unbalanced line inputs. A separate phono connection can be configured for either moving-coil or moving-magnet cartridges. The digital input bank includes two coaxial connections and two optical connections. The CS7500 also has one MCT input, one USB input and one HDMI ARC connection.
Network playback includes Apple AirPlay and Google Cast. Direct service access covers Qobuz Connect, Spotify Connect and TIDAL Connect. The preamplifier is both Roon Ready and Roon Tested. Its Bluetooth receiver supports AAC, Qualcomm aptX HD and Qualcomm aptX Adaptive codecs.
The output section provides two pairs of balanced variable connections and two pairs of unbalanced variable connections. The second variable-output sets can be configured for either one or two subwoofers. A separate pair of unbalanced outputs operates at fixed level, and the CS7500 also has a 1/4-inch High Drive headphone output. Maximum output is 16V RMS through the balanced connections and 8V RMS through the unbalanced connections.
The chassis measures 17.5 x 6 x 17 inches and weighs 25 lb. Power consumption is 30 watts when the unit is switched on. The McIntosh CS7500 became available through authorized McIntosh dealers on 26 August 2026.
Key specifications
Product type | Two-channel solid-state streaming preamplifier |
|---|---|
Channels | 2 |
Analog inputs | 6: 2 balanced, 3 unbalanced, and 1 configurable moving-coil/moving-magnet phono input |
Digital inputs | 7: 2 coaxial, 2 optical, 1 MCT, 1 USB, and 1 HDMI ARC |
Streaming support | Apple AirPlay, Bluetooth, Google Cast, Qobuz Connect, Spotify Connect, TIDAL Connect, Roon Ready, and Roon Tested |
Bluetooth codecs | AAC, Qualcomm aptX HD, and Qualcomm aptX Adaptive |
DAC | Quad Balanced eight-channel DAC architecture |
USB PCM and DXD support | PCM from 32-bit/44.1kHz to 384kHz; DXD at 352.8kHz and 384kHz |
Coaxial and optical input support | 24-bit/44.1kHz to 192kHz |
Total harmonic distortion | 0.005% |
Frequency response | +0/-0.5dB from 20Hz to 20kHz; +0/-3dB from 15Hz to 100kHz |
Maximum output | 16V RMS balanced; 8V RMS unbalanced |
